Automotive Relays
An automotive relay is an electrically operated switch used to control high-power devices in a vehicle, such as lights, motors, and HVAC systems. It allows low-power signals to control higher-current circuits, ensuring efficient operation of electrical components. Designed for durability, automotive relays are resistant to heat, moisture, and vibrations, providing reliable performance in harsh environments.
